A high body mass index (BMI) is specifically linked to an increased risk of endometrial cancer, which affects the lining of the uterus. Obesity can lead to hormonal changes, particularly elevated estrogen levels, which may promote the development of this type of cancer. Additionally, excess body fat is associated with inflammation and insulin resistance, further contributing to cancer risk. Other cancers, such as breast and colorectal, are also linked to high BMI, but endometrial cancer shows a particularly strong association.
To be obese you need to have a Body Mass Index (BMI) of more than 30. BMI is calculated using the formula: BMI = weight (in Kg) / height2 (in meters) * Any BMI > 40 is severe obesity * A BMI of 40.0-49.9 is morbid obesity * A BMI of >50 is super obese Excessive body weight is associated with various diseases, particularly cardiovascular diseases, diabetes mellitus type 2, obstructive sleep apnea, certain types of cancer, and osteoarthritis. The average height for a female model is between 5'8" and 5'11" and for male models it is 5'11" to 6'1". Body proportion is key with measurements of 34-24-34 for female models being considered the most desireable. The average BMI for top models is 16.3 (healthy is between 18.5 and 25).
